


Description
This striking sculpture features a hand-carved ram skull, its sweeping horns lavishly gilded in gold leaf. Emerging from a richly ornate frame and mounted against a mirror, the piece blurs the line between object and reflection, reality and illusion. The skull appears to extend beyond the mirror’s surface, confronting the viewer with both its physical presence and its mirrored double.
The ram, a symbol of strength, determination, and sacrifice, is here transformed into a gilded relic—elevated from natural form to a work of reverence and memory. The use of gold leaf evokes opulence and ritual, contrasting with the dark, textured skull beneath. The frame and mirror create a sense of theatricality, echoing traditions of vanitas and memento mori while reimagining the trophy mount as a contemporary artwork.
